StarDict представляет собой программную оболочку с открытым исходным кодом, которая созданная для поддержки и работы со словарями StarDic. Этот пакет обладает массой возможностей и позволяет применять довольно широкие возможности не только при переводе слов и предложений, но и в области прослушивания правильного произношения. Более того, данный программный пакет включает множество словарей различных наречий.
Основные возможности программы StarDict
Начнем с того, что база словарей, которая включена в этот пакет, действительно просто огромна. По сути своей, словари распределены на несколько групп. Это Longman Dictionary of Contemporary English 5th Ed, Oxford Advanced Learner's Dictionary, Merriam-Webster's Collegiate 11th Ed, Longman Pronunciation Dictionary 3rd Ed, Cambridge Advanced Learners Dictionary 3th Ed и Macmillan English Dictionary. В свою очередь, каждая из этих групп разбита на несколько подразделов по тематике, по наречиям и т. д.
Что касается основных возможностей программы, то они весьма необычны. Особе внимание в построении всего программного пакета и использования словарей уделено, в первую очередь, поисковой системе. Можно совершенно свободно задавать поиск по шаблону, а также использовать, так называемый, «нечеткий запрос». При этом для распознавания слов используется алгоритм Левенштейна, который дает возможность сравнить несколько слов на предмет похожести, исходя из частично введенного запроса. Для использования такой системы поиска каждый запрос должен начинаться с символа «/». Также, можно воспользоваться ми полнотекстовым поиском, который является, хоть и более медленным, однако, позволяет искать целые предложения по статьям, представленным в программе.
Приложение позволяет по сочетанию нажатий нескольких клавиш отображать перевод во всплывающем окне. Это, так называемая функция сканирования выделенного текста. Более того, словарь может автоматически подключаться к словарным поисковым системам в Интернете и, используя онлайн-сервисы, выдавать перевод или наиболее употребительные сочетания из других источников. И точно так же легко можно переводить целые тексты и статьи с использованием множества доступных онлайн-переводчиков.
Довольно грамотно построена и система управления словарями. При желании можно отключать неиспользуемые словари или, например, задавать очередность использования словарей при поиске. Ну, скажем, можно задать сначала использование общего словаря, затем технического и т. д. И именно в этом порядке будет производиться вывод результатов перевода.
Одним из преимуществ всего пакета является возможность подключения звуковых модулей, роль которых просто невозможно не оценить. В данном случае можно не только увидеть перевод слова или транскрипцию, но и прослушать его правильное произношение, даже с учетом нескольких вариантов наречий.
В заключении хочется сказать, что данный программный пакет обладает дружественным и интуитивно понятным интерфейсом, с которым довольно легко и просто работать. К тому же, последняя версия пакета вышла в 2011 году. При этом были обновлены, практически все словари и файлы.
Комментарии к программе:
C StarDict еще никто не сталкивался с проблемами